Medical Examiner Dr. Qin (Chinese: 法医秦明) is a 2016 Chinese streaming television series adapted from the novel The Eleventh Finger (Chinese: 第十一根手指) by Qin Ming.[2][1] It follows an investigative team consisting of medical examiner Qin Ming, his assistant Li Dabao and police officer Lin Tao as they solve mysterious criminal cases.[2]
Produced by Beijing Bojitianjuan Film and TV, the series premiered in October 2016 on the streaming serviceSohu TV. A second season ran in April 2017 and the third was broadcast in 2018.[3]
The series is one of the most successful network drama on Sohu TV, with 1.5 billion views.[3] Considered as a pioneer of its genre, the series helped shed light on the profession of a forensic doctor by delving into their hardships and professional working attitudes.[2] It has been praised for its bold plots, tense storyline and good-looking performers.[2] The series was also ranked as one of the top 10 web dramas at the 2016 ENAwards.[4]
